Rattray’s Sir William in a 1935-1939-ish Kaywoodie 5163 (Super Grain Medium Unger Oom Paul) accompanied me on my pre-work stroll. I am glad I haven’t stocked up much Rattray’s Stirling Flake, because I am finding Sir William even more to my liking. The whiskey topping is judiciously applied, but evident in the smoke. The tobaccos have many of the flavors I like in Stirling Flake but with some added Gawith Hoggarth notes from the dark air cured leaf.
